The Obion County Public Library facility was opened in November of 2003 and located at 1221 E. Reelfoot Avenue in Union City, Tennessee. The facility has a 30,000 square foot building on approximately 4 acres of land.  Learn More Here

Book Donations

We accept book, DVD, and Blu-Ray donations. Any donated items that cannot be put into circulation will go to our Friends of the Library Book Sale
